Queso fresco

Mild, milky, and lightly salty, with a soft, crumbly texture that doesn't fully melt.

Lens analyzed

Queso fresco is a fresh, unaged Mexican cheese with a crumbly texture and a mild, milky, slightly salty flavor. Unlike melting cheeses, it softens but holds its shape when heated, making it common as a finishing crumble rather than a melted filling.

Where it comes from

Queso fresco developed as a simple farmhouse cheese across Mexico and Central America, made quickly without aging, and it remains a staple topping across tacos, salads, and beans in both traditional and North American Mexican cooking.

Buying it

Look for a moist, white block with no discoloration or dried edges, since it's meant to be eaten fresh rather than aged. Because it doesn't keep as long as harder cheeses, buy an amount you'll use up soon.

Storing it

Keep it refrigerated in its original packaging or wrapped tightly, and use it within about two weeks since it's an unaged, fresh cheese. Discard it if you notice sliminess or an off smell.

Keeps about 14 days in the fridge.
